If you love Hawaiian Luau type show - fire twirling, hula dancers, tiki huts, roast chicken & ribs, pineapple, rice, salad, then you can try the Polynesian Luau show.
Menu -> http://www.allearsnet.com/din/luau.htm

If you like laid back slap stick entertainement, fried chicken & ribs, baked beans, corn, salad with dressing already on it - do the Hoop Dee Doo show at Ft. Wilderness.
Menu -> http://www.allearsnet.com/din/hddcom.htm

Both shows take your pciture and offer you a picture package (your choice to purchase it).

Both shows are pre-paid and both have discounts at the last show.

You can secure seats at the 180 day mark for both shows starting in 2007.
For shows this year, seats can be secured up to 2 years before.

You can pick up your tickets for both shows at any WDW resort up to 7 days before your show date.

With all that said my family enjoyed Mickey's Backyard Barbeccu best of all. I didn't see a prior comment about it and i am not sure if they still do it but it was the same kind of food as Hoops, they have a band that plays with jokes, rope tricks, and then they teach everyone a few dances where you actually get on the dance floor and try. Then 2 different times they have Mickey, Minnie, Goofy, Chip, and Dale come out for a time for pictures and autographs.
